| Summary: | The domination of e-commerce industry is sided to product based business whereas the service oriented business for small-to-medium sized enterprises (SME) is still lagging behind in this competitive industry. The most popular e-commerce platform in Southeast Asia such as Shopee and Lazada have recorded 200 million and 174 million in total for mobile web and desktop visits respectively. In this project, an application called WeFix has been proposed to serve as a platform for business owner who wants to promote their services to local community in Kota Samarahan. The services offered is mainly for repairing related service such as electronic devices, home appliances and vehicles
and it is targeted for residential areas within Kota Samarahan. |
